#include "config.h"
#include "wtf/text/TextPosition.h"
#include "wtf/PassOwnPtr.h"
#include "wtf/StdLibExtras.h"
namespace WTF {
PassOwnPtr<Vector<unsigned> > lineEndings(const String& text)
{
OwnPtr<Vector<unsigned> > result(adoptPtr(new Vector<unsigned>()));
unsigned start = 0;
while (start < text.length()) {
size_t lineEnd = text.find('\n', start);
if (lineEnd == notFound)
break;
result->append(static_cast<unsigned>(lineEnd));
start = lineEnd + 1;
}
result->append(text.length());
return result.release();
}
static inline unsigned valueExtractor(const unsigned* value)
{
return *value;
}
TextPosition TextPosition::fromOffsetAndLineEndings(unsigned offset, const Vector<unsigned>& lineEndings)
{
const unsigned* foundLineEnding = approximateBinarySearch<unsigned, unsigned>(lineEndings, lineEndings.size(), offset, valueExtractor);
int lineIndex = foundLineEnding - &lineEndings.at(0);
if (offset > *foundLineEnding)
++lineIndex;
unsigned lineStartOffset = lineIndex > 0 ? lineEndings.at(lineIndex - 1) + 1 : 0;
int column = offset - lineStartOffset;
return TextPosition(OrdinalNumber::fromZeroBasedInt(lineIndex), OrdinalNumber::fromZeroBasedInt(column));
}
} // namespace WTF
